2003 Acura MDX

Question: estimate for timing belt and water pump replacement

I need an estimate of timing belt replacement and water pump replacement done at the same time for a 2003 Acura MDX with 110000 miles on it. This is the scheduled maintenance for 105,000 miles. I have already changed the oil and rotated the tires.

    No offence intended to any prior responces - you can get this job done as cheep as 800.00 or so but if you want quality parts and a new tensioner, coolant flush, new drive belts and the whole job done right and well you will spend 1050.00 to 1250.00. Spend it once and have it done right!! Good luck, Greg
